AmCham Ghana Engaged Students From Bunker Hill Community College

The American Chamber of Commerce, Ghana, on Wednesday, June 26, 2024, engaged students from Bunker Hills Community College in Boston, Massachusetts, on the subject of U.S.-Ghana relations, global culture practices, and dynamics in business trade. This meeting was attended by 10 students and 3 faculty members

We delved into the complexities of international relations, focusing mainly on the U.S.’s role in Ghana and across Africa.

Throughout the dialogue, students inquire into Ghana’s promising business environment alongside the challenges of international collaboration.

Conversations also scrutinized the impact of U.S. foreign policy on African nations, underlining diplomacy’s pivotal role in promoting global harmony. From commerce to geopolitics, the discussion underscored the profound significance of cross-cultural knowledge in today’s interconnected world trade and establishment between the U.S. and Ghana.
